The role
The US Director of Development will drive the growth of our work in the US by (a) increasing grants from private, family, community, and corporate foundations, (b) building a new pipeline of individual major gifts. They will work with the Executive Director, CEO, and respective program leads in designing, developing and delivering a series of exciting development opportunities to support overall growth in the US market.
The post holder will oversee and manage foundation grants and individual major gifts in tandem with our US Executive Director. Responsibilities include researching prospects, identifying and building relationships with them, and developing bespoke proposals. The incumbent will oversee development, compliance, reporting, and coordination.

The ideal candidate
The ideal candidate will have impeccable writing and verbal communication skills, and a keen understanding of development, moves management, donor stewardship and fundraising ethics. Key to success in this role is the ability to speak to the full suite of ISD programming to pitch to potential partners and deliver quick turnaround concepts that can lead to development wins for ISD-US.
